As we know that when it comes to the software testing methodology, usually, there're 3 steps for us to go through:
1.Creating the test strategy. This step should be the essential precondition for the following 2 steps as it's a must for a test team to analyze the requirement of clients, the resource we need, and overall function of the objective software, furthermore, the relations among those factors above. Thereby, a blueprint should be drawn in advance. In short, the test strategy is more like a guideline or a principal for testers to follow in the 2nd step and the 3rd step.
2. Creating the test plan. This step should be done after the test strategy's established. Compared with the test strategy, a test plan seems to be more detail-oriented which means that it should be designed as an agenda or a schedule or a procedure, so to speak, for testers to follow in the 3rd step. For example, the setting of milestones, plans upon different function modules in the software, etc.
3. Executing the test. Once the first 2 steps are prepared enough, this step wouldn't cause so much chaos in the brains of testers. LOL
